11:03 — The Parcelain tracking webhook began returning 200s while silently discarding payloads after a deserializer update. Downstream status updates stalled for roughly forty minutes before the Skoda-team alert fired. Rollback restored delivery at 11:47. New folks: always verify the deployed webhook version against the token shown below.

pipeline stamp: htk9_ce63042d9

Digest scheduling: the Mailwright batch job runs hourly on the Falkner cluster. If digests stall, check the queue depth first, then restart the scheduler pod. Do not bump cron frequency without sign-off from Priya's team. Restarts require the scheduler to re-authenticate against Mailwright's internal API, so keep the key below handy.

app token of bawep-hafog = kto7_vwrmnlx

### Capacity Note: SQL Lint Pipeline

The Thorngale lint service parses every committed SQL file to flag injection-prone string concatenation and over-broad grants. Reviewers should know that parser memory grows roughly linearly with statement nesting depth, so the depth cap doubles as both a capacity control and a defense against crafted pathological files. Worker counts and per-file limits were sized for peak merge windows. The provisioning constants follow.

tuning table, kajog-kawef:
PRIORITIES = {
    "kelox": 870,
    "kasix": 89,
    "eliax": 988,
}

Account recovery runbook — Pellwick Reports. Exports from the Tallgrove scheduler render timestamps in UTC regardless of tenant locale; do not "fix" this in recovery flows. If a locked account needs its export history rebuilt, re-run the sweep with the tenant's stored offset. To unlock the recovery console, use the passphrase below.

recovery phrase for fafof-kagaf: eliath-zormir